MySQL实现CRUD操作快速简便的数据操作方式(mysql中crud)

MySQL实现CRUD操作

MySQL是一种关系型数据库管理系统,广泛应用于大量的Web应用程序。MySQL能够实现CRUD操作,即Create(创建)、Retrieve(查询)、Update(更新)和Delete(删除)操作,使得数据的操作变得快速简便。本文将介绍如何使用MySQL实现CRUD操作。

1.连接MySQL数据库

连接MySQL数据库的方式有多种,例如使用Java连接MySQL、使用Python连接MySQL等。下面以Java为例介绍如何连接MySQL数据库。

(1)先要在Java项目中导入MySQL驱动包。

(2)使用以下代码连接MySQL数据库。

“`java

Class.forName(“com.mysql.jdbc.Driver”);

String url = “jdbc:mysql://localhost:3306/database_name?useSSL=false&serverTimezone=UTC”;

String user = “username”;

String password = “password”;

Connection conn = DriverManager.getConnection(url, user, password);


其中,`DriverManager.getConnection()`方法用于建立与MySQL服务器之间的连接。

2.实现CRUD操作

(1)创建数据表

使用MySQL,可以使用以下语句创建数据表。

```sql
CREATE TABLE `student`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(32) NOT NULL,
`age` int(11) NOT NULL,
`gender` varchar(8)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;

上述代码创建了一个名为`student`的数据表,包含4个字段:`id`、`name`、`age`和`gender`。其中,`id`为自增长整数类型,作为主键;`name`和`gender`为字符类型;`age`为数字类型。

(2)插入数据

使用以下语句可以向`student`数据表中插入一条数据。

“`sql

INSERT INTO `student` (`name`, `age`, `gender`)

VALUES (‘Tom’, 18, ‘Male’);


上述代码向`student`数据表中插入了一条名为Tom的男性的年龄为18的记录。

(3)查询数据

使用以下语句可以从`student`数据表中查询所有数据。

```sql
SELECT * FROM `student`;

上述代码从`student`数据表中查询所有记录,并返回包含所有字段的结果集。

(4)更新数据

使用以下语句可以更新`student`数据表中的一条记录。

“`sql

UPDATE `student` SET `age` = 19 WHERE `name` = ‘Tom’;


上述代码将`student`数据表中名为Tom的记录的年龄从18修改为19。

(5)删除数据

使用以下语句可以删除`student`数据表中的一条记录。

```sql
DELETE FROM `student` WHERE `name` = 'Tom';

上述代码从`student`数据表中删除名为Tom的记录。

3.总结

本文介绍了使用MySQL实现CRUD操作的方法。连接MySQL数据库并创建数据表、插入数据、查询数据、更新数据和删除数据,能够让数据的操作变得快速简便。


数据运维技术 » MySQL实现CRUD操作快速简便的数据操作方式(mysql中crud)